For the safety of our students and spectators:
Gates/Doors will open for games/events no earlier than 45 minutes prior to the game/event. Students are not allowed to stay after school until a game/event begins unless they are part of a school activity with a school sponsor supervising them.
Students in grades K-6 must be accompanied by a parent or responsible adult to all extracurricular activities. Students should be seated with their family .
Students will not be allowed to run, play football/toys in the football stadium area including the grassy areas.
Thank you for your help in keeping our kids and spectators safe at our school events.
